Last Chance to View 1,150-Year-Old Comet and Meteors Tonight

Comet Lemmon and Comet SWAN are at their brightest and most visible in the night sky on October 21, offering a rare opportunity to see them with binoculars before they fade or become harder to observe due to moonlight. Lemmon is visible in the northwest after sunset and before sunrise, while SWAN appears in the southwest after sunset, both best viewed in dark, pollution-free areas.

Bright Comets Lemmon and SWAN Light Up October Skies

This week, two comets, Lemmon and SWAN, will reach their brightest and closest points to Earth, offering a rare opportunity for skywatchers to observe them. Comet Lemmon will be visible near the Big Dipper's handle and will be about 56 million miles from Earth, while Comet SWAN can be seen near the Summer Triangle, about 24 million miles away. Both comets are on vastly different orbits, with Lemmon returning in 3179 and SWAN having a 20,000-year orbit.

Comet SWAN (C/2025 R2) Emerges as a Bright, Unexpected Visitor in the Night Sky

The new bright comet C/2025 R2 (SWAN) was discovered by SOHO, originated from a different direction than 3I/ATLAS, and has an orbital period of 286 years. It approached close to the Sun on September 12, 2025, and will potentially be associated with a meteor shower as Earth crosses its orbit. Avi Loeb discusses the comet's origin, its relation to interstellar objects like 3I/ATLAS, and reflects on the possibility of extraterrestrial life, inspired by a song titled 'Aliens Are Real' by Oli Swan.

"Autonomous 'SWAN' Shuttle Service Expands to Orlando Theme Parks and Treasure Island"

The City of Orlando is launching a six-month pilot program for the SWAN Shuttle, an autonomous vehicle powered by Beep technologies. The shuttle will operate on a one-mile loop during off-peak hours, connecting LYNX Central Station to various locations in Creative Village. The SWAN shuttles, which seat eight passengers, will be free to use and will run from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. and from 6:30 p.m. to 10:30 p.m. daily.

"Beloved NY Swan Killed and Eaten, Teens Charged"

Three teenagers have been charged with grand larceny, criminal mischief, conspiracy, and criminal trespassing after killing and eating Faye, a beloved swan who lived in an Upstate New York pond. The suspects, who were neighborhood friends, hopped the Manlius Swan Pond fence in the middle of the night during Memorial Day weekend, held down and killed Faye at the pond, and ate her. The suspects expressed that they believed the swan was just "a very large duck." The incident was caught on surveillance footage. Two of Faye's babies were found at a shopping center, and the other two were found at a home in Syracuse. The Village of Manlius is currently taking care of the four babies.

Controversy Surrounds Killing of Beloved Swans in Manlius, NY

Eman Hussan, an 18-year-old teenager, was arrested and charged with grand larceny, conspiracy, and criminal trespassing for allegedly killing and eating a town-owned swan named Faye on Memorial Day. Hussan and his two underage accomplices also kidnapped Faye's four babies. The incident caused grief to Faye's mate, Manny, who may be removed from the pond where they lived to prevent him from becoming combative. The teenagers allegedly hunted for fun, not for lack of food. Hussan was released on his own recognizance and is due in court on June 15.

Teens Arrested for Killing and Eating Beloved New York Village Swan

Three teenagers in Manlius, New York, stole and killed a beloved swan named Faye, mistaking it for a "very large duck," and then ate it. The swans have been living in the village since 1905, and residents have a deep appreciation for them. The teenagers were charged with felony counts of grand larceny and criminal mischief, as well as misdemeanor counts of conspiracy of theft and criminal trespassing. The incident has shocked the community, and officials hope to continue the village's long tradition of having swans at the pond.

Beloved Manlius Swan Faye Killed and Eaten by Teens in New York Village.

Three teenagers allegedly beheaded Faye, a mother swan, and stole her babies from the Manlius swan pond. They then took Faye back to one of their homes on Syracuse's Northside and ate her. The cygnets are now under the care of a biologist. The two younger suspects will go through the family court process, which means their records will be sealed from the public. The 18-year-old is also eligible for youthful offender status.
